## Account Recovery — Trailnote Offline Mode

When a surveyor's Trailnote app has been offline for 30+ days, their local credentials expire and sync refuses to resume. Don't make them wipe the device — all their unsynced field data lives there! Instead, open the support console, pick "Offline Reinstate," and enter their handle. The console will ask for the support team's shared recovery passphrase before issuing a reinstatement token. Use the one below.

unlock words, bagaf-fajeg: zorael-kelax-fraath-quenix-eliok-sileth-aldmir-wenir-druiel

### Runbook: BounceBroom — Account Recovery

If the BounceBroom email bounce processor loses access to its service account, do not create a new one. First, pause the intake queue so bounces buffer safely. Then open the recovery console and select the BounceBroom principal. Verification requires approval from the on-call lead. Once approved, the console prompts for the stored recovery credentials; enter the passphrase that appears directly below this paragraph.

recovery phrase for fahof-kahap: holion-gormir-jorix-istix-briwyn-sorael

## v2.4.1 — Cron drift fix

- Pinned the Larkspin job runner to a single clock source; drift between hosts caused double-fires.
- Added drift alert at 45s deviation.
- On-call: if alerts persist after rollout, roll back and page immediately.

Questions about the investigation should go to the engineer named below.

account owner for fajep-yagef: Kasix Eliiel

FAQ: Flaky DNS on Bristlecap staging

Q: Resolution for staging hosts intermittently fails during releases. Why?
A: The Bristlecap resolver caches negative answers for 10 minutes; new hosts registered mid-release hit stale NXDOMAIN entries. Flush the resolver from the release console, then retry. If the console itself is unreachable, use the emergency flush tool, which requires the on-call recovery passphrase. The passphrase is listed below.

unlock words, hahap-yawig: pelix-kelion-tamys-jorix-julok

Env vars for Paperfold, our PDF invoice renderer, discussed at this week's sync. PAPERFOLD_DPI controls raster quality, PAPERFOLD_LOCALE sets number formatting, and PAPERFOLD_QUEUE_URL points at the render queue. All are safe to share in logs except the storage credential, which Tindale ops rotates monthly. In the canonical .env, that credential appears immediately after this comment line.

env line for fafof-fahag: LEDGER_TOKEN5=f8790